520 _aA study was conducted to evaluate the current standard of practice for the design and construction of municipal solid waste (MSW) landfills in Thailand. From the findings of this study, it was concluded that Thailand is approaching internationally accepted standards for design and construction of the MSW landfills. The study was started with the review of design and construction of ten recently engineered landfills, then it became more specific to the four of them, namely Pathumthani, Sri Racha, Nakhon Sawan, and Hua Hin. Evaluation was made on the basis of design, construction, and specification of liner, site selection and construction practices of the MSW landfills. Factor of safety of the landfills were calculated by PCSTABL5M computer program. The minimum factor of safety of Pathumthani, Sri Racha, Nakhon Sawan, and Hua Hin landfill were 1.56, 1.61, 1.65, and 1.63 respectively. Refuse settlement was calculated by SOWERS model. Results showed that the settlement in all the landfills was under acceptable limit. The liner stability was evaluated by adopting the methodology given by GIROUD and BEECH (1989).
